The most theoretically sound method of accounting for cash discounts on credit sales is the

A) net price method
B) discounted price method
C) gross price method
D) net present value method

Net Price Method

A pricing strategy that applies discounts and allowances to the gross price to determine the final sale price.

Cash Discounts

Cash discounts are reductions in the price of goods or services offered to buyers as an incentive for early payment.

Final Answer :
A
Explanation :
The net price method is the most theoretically sound method of accounting for cash discounts on credit sales. It recognizes the discount at the time of sale and records the sale at its net amount. This method ensures that revenue is recognized at the amount that the company expects to collect, rather than an inflated amount that may not be received due to the discount offered. The other methods listed (discounted price method, gross price method, and net present value method) do not accurately reflect the true value of the sale and can potentially overstate revenue.
